Traditional American Designs
Known as American Traditional, this style is characterized by strong, clean lines and a limited color palette, typically featuring reds, greens, yellows, and blacks. Common motifs include roses, anchors, eagles, and skulls. These pinterest neck tattoos are known for their ability to age well, looking great for decades.
Minimalist and Geometric Tattoos
For those who prefer a more modern look, minimalist tattoos are an excellent choice. This style is all about fine lines, simple shapes, and uncluttered composition. Geometric tattoos fall into this category, using structured forms like circles, triangles, and mandalas to create visually striking pinterest neck tattoos. This style is great for a discreet yet meaningful piece of art.
Vibrant Watercolor Styles
A modern trend, watercolor tattoos replicate the look of a painting. They utilize soft color blending, splatters, and a an absence of solid black outlines. This technique creates a fluid, vibrant, and artistic effect on the skin. This style is wonderful for nature-inspired, creative, and colorful pinterest neck tattoos.
